USB 3.0 PCIe + USB 3.0 schijf: random disconnect

Pagina: 1
Acties:

Acties:
  • 0 Henk 'm!

  • Mentalist
  • Registratie: Oktober 2001
  • Laatst online: 30-08 02:04
Ik heb een externe USB 3.0 harde schijf van Medion met Seagate ST2000DL003 2TB schijf erin. Voor in de PC heb ik een Transcend TS-PDU3 kaartje gekocht (2 poorten USB 3.0, PCIe x1, D720200AF chipje). Mijn OS is Ubuntu 11.04 (ik sla meestal een versie over want iedere versie heeft weer nieuwe onhebbelijkheden :P).

Met de meegeleverde kabel sluit ik de harde schijf aan en alles werkt. Lekker snel. Dus ik start mijn hardeschijf testscript dat er in een loop bestanden opzet en de MD5 daarvan checkt. Na 300GB staat het volgende in de dmesg:
[12626.000303] xhci_hcd 0000:04:00.0: xHCI host not responding to stop endpoint command.
[12626.000313] xhci_hcd 0000:04:00.0: Assuming host is dying, halting host.
[12626.005144] xhci_hcd 0000:04:00.0: Non-responsive xHCI host is not halting.
[12626.005150] xhci_hcd 0000:04:00.0: Completing active URBs anyway.
[12626.005173] xhci_hcd 0000:04:00.0: HC died; cleaning up
[12626.005292] usb 5-1: USB disconnect, address 2
[12626.005851] sd 9:0:0:0: Device offlined - not ready after error recovery
[12626.009412] sd 9:0:0:0: [sdc] Unhandled error code
[12626.009419] sd 9:0:0:0: [sdc] Result: hostbyte=DID_NO_CONNECT driverbyte=DRIVER_OK
[12626.009428] sd 9:0:0:0: [sdc] CDB: Write(10): 2a 00 97 f4 75 c0 00 00 f0 00
[12626.009447] end_request: I/O error, dev sdc, sector 2549380544
[12626.053194] FAT: FAT read failed (blocknr 32)
[12626.053242] FAT: FAT read failed (blocknr 32)
[12626.060573] FAT: FAT read failed (blocknr 32)
[12626.060625] FAT: FAT read failed (blocknr 32)
[12626.060655] FAT: unable to read inode block for updating (i_pos 15258627)
[12626.160027] FAT: FAT read failed (blocknr 32)
[12626.160027] FAT: FAT read failed (blocknr 32)
[12626.160027] FAT: unable to read inode block for updating (i_pos 15258627)
[12626.260246] FAT: FAT read failed (blocknr 32)
[12626.260272] FAT: FAT read failed (blocknr 32)
[12626.260285] FAT: unable to read inode block for updating (i_pos 15258627)
In het kort: de harde schijf was opeens gewoon pleite.

Na de stekker eruit en terug in te hebben gedaan doet de schijf het weer, maar dit is natuurlijk niet acceptabel. Ik had hem eerder ook op USB 2.0 getest, en daar deed hij twee runs van 400GB en 430GB zonder problemen (die duurden natuurlijk wel veel langer).

Iemand een idee waarom de schijf opeens disconnect, of hoe ik iets kan testen? Ik heb geen andere USB 3.0 controllers, dus die kan ik niet swappen.

Verstuurd vanaf mijn Computer®


Acties:
  • 0 Henk 'm!

Verwijderd

Helaas heb ik daar wel een idee over hoe dat komt, of je er vrolijk van gaat worden is een heel ander verhaal....

Het erg uitgebreide antwoord vind je in de onderstaande externe link.

http://forums.whirlpool.net.au/archive/1558885

Om een lang verhaal kort te maken zijn er weer eens issues met een veel toegepaste JMicron controller, Firmware en software. Ook vind je een lijst met apparaten die zijn uitgerust met deze brakke Jmicron controller en daarnaast ook apparaten die wel goed werken.

Het ziet er naar uit dat USB 3.0 nog erg veel kinderziektes heeft in de vorm van brakke controllers, slechte firmware, hitte problemen, aansluitproblemen en software conflicten. 7(8)7

Sterkte........

.............. <+:) ...............
_/-\o_ _/-\o_ _/-\o_ _/-\o_
_/-\o_ _/-\o_ _/-\o_ _/-\o_
_/-\o_ _/-\o_ _/-\o_ _/-\o_